#709fb3 - RGB(112, 159, 179) - Neptune Color FAQ

What is the color code for Neptune?

Hex color code for Neptune color is #709fb3. RGB color code for neptune color is rgb(112, 159, 179).

What is the RGB value of #709fb3?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#709fb3 is rgb(112, 159, 179).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'112' indicates the intensity of the red component, '159' represents the green component's intensity, and '179'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#709fb3.

What does RGB 112,159,179 mean?

The RGB color 112, 159, 179 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 6699cc.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Neptune.
